Summary

This Form 8-K filing by The NASDAQ OMX Group, Inc. (NDAQ) on May 7, 2009, primarily serves to announce and provide access to their financial results for the first quarter of 2009. The report indicates that a press release detailing these results was issued on the same day, and presentation slides were made available on their website. Investors looking for specific financial performance data will need to refer to the attached Exhibit 99.1 (the press release) for details on revenue, profitability, and other key operational metrics for the quarter. While the 8-K itself does not contain the detailed financial figures, it acts as a formal notification and a gateway to the primary source of that information. The filing falls under Regulation FD, ensuring that material information is disseminated fairly to all investors. The lack of other substantive items suggests that this filing's main purpose was the timely disclosure of Q1 2009 earnings.
